Understanding Foggy Windows
Foggy windows are an outcome of a stopped working seal in insulated glass units (IGUs). IGUs are created to have 2 or more layers of glass with a sealed area between them, often filled with air or a noble gas like argon. This design supplies insulation and minimizes heat transfer, making the windows more energy-efficient. Nevertheless, if the seal between the glass layers breaks, moisture can permeate in, resulting in a foggy look and decreased performance.

Q: What causes fog to form between the panes of a double-pane window?A: Fog kinds when the seal in between the glass panes stops working, permitting wetness to enter the sealed space. This can be due to bad installation, age, manufacturing defects, physical damage, or ecological aspects.
Q: Can foggy windows be repaired, or do they require to be replaced?A: Minor fogging can often be repaired with temporary repairs like window defogging kits. However, severe fogging or broken seals typically require expert repair or total window replacement.
Q: Will the fog disappear on its own?A: No, the fog will not go away on its own. As soon as the seal is broken, moisture will continue to collect, resulting in a consistent foggy look and potential damage.
Q: How much does it cost to repair a foggy window?A: The expense can differ depending upon the degree of the damage and the picked repair approach. Short-lived fixes can cost around ₤ 20 to ₤ 50, while professional repairs or replacements can range from ₤ 100 to ₤ 500 or more per window.
